    U.S. Marine Gunnery Sgt. Frank Dugger, the maintenance control chief for Marine Heavy Helicopter Squadron 463, nearly died from two cardiac episodes while deployed to Afghanistan in 2009. The 41-year-old native of Tallahassee, Fla., used his second chance to turn his life around. He quit drinking, began eating more healthily and decided to complete a triathlon. Less than a year later, he completed an Ironman triathlon in Cozumel, Mexico. In total, he's finished 9 marathons and 30 triathlons.
